Abstract:
We present a simple geometric and combinatorial algorithm for the approximate partial matching problem of small 3D point landmark patterns. It has been designed for and successfully applied in a computer aided neurosurgery navigation system. The algorithm relies mainly on a geometric voting and scoring technique.
